如何实现“龙蜥 MySQL”数据库
在实现“龙蜥 MySQL”的过程中,有几个主要步骤需要我们逐步完成。作为一个初学者,你可以根据下面的表格和详细的代码示例,来逐步实施。
一、流程概览
下面是实现“龙蜥 MySQL”的基本流程:
步骤 | 说明 |
---|---|
1 | 安装 MySQL |
2 | 创建数据库 |
3 | 创建数据表 |
4 | 插入数据 |
5 | 查询数据 |
6 | 更新数据 |
7 | 删除数据 |
8 | 结束与 MySQL 的连接 |
二、每一步详解
1. 安装 MySQL
首先,确保你的计算机上已经安装了 MySQL。可以到 [MySQL 官网]( 下载最新版本,按照引导完成安装。
如果你已经安装,可以用登录命令确认安装成功:
mysql -u root -p
2. 创建数据库
在确认 MySQL 安装成功后,接下来我们要创建一个数据库。下面是创建数据库的 SQL 语句:
CREATE DATABASE longxi;
- 这条语句是在 MySQL 中创建一个名为
longxi
的新数据库。
3. 创建数据表
接下来我们需要在刚才创建的数据库中创建数据表。例如,我们可以创建一个用户信息表:
USE longxi; -- 选择使用 longxi 数据库
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Y, -- 用户ID,自动递增
name VARCHAR(100) NOT NULL, -- 用户名,不允许为空
email VARCHAR(100) NOT NULL UNIQUE -- 用户邮箱,不允许为空且唯一
);
USE longxi;
:选择使用longxi
数据库。CREATE TABLE users
:创建一个名为users
的表。AUTO_INCREMENT
:表示id
字段会自动增加。NOT NULL
:确保字段不能为 NULL。UNIQUE
:确保字段值唯一。
4. 插入数据
现在,我们来为 users
表插入一些数据。可以使用如下 SQL 语句:
INSERT INTO users (name, email) VALUES
('Alice', 'alice@example.com'),
('Bob', 'bob@example.com');
INSERT INTO users
:向users
表插入数据。VALUES
:指定要插入的具体数据。
5. 查询数据
插入数据后,可以查询表中的数据,使用下列 SQL 语句:
SELECT * FROM users;
SELECT *
:选择所有字段。FROM users
:从users
表中查询。
6. 更新数据
若想更新某个用户的信息,可以使用以下 SQL 语句:
UPDATE users
SET email = 'alice_new@example.com'
WHERE name = 'Alice';
UPDATE users
:指明要更新users
表。SET email = '...
:指定要更改的字段和值。WHERE name = 'Alice'
:确定要更新的具体记录。
7. 删除数据
若要删除某个用户,可以使用以下 SQL 语句:
DELETE FROM users WHERE name = 'Bob';
DELETE FROM users
:从users
表中删除记录。WHERE name = 'Bob'
:确定要删除的具体记录。
8. 结束与 MySQL 的连接
完成所有操作后,确保安全地断开与 MySQL 的连接。可以使用以下命令:
EXIT;
EXIT;
:结束与 MySQL 的会话。
数据操作的可视化
下面是一个用饼图(Pie Chart)展示用户邮箱状态的简单示例。我们可以使用 Mermaid 语法来展示。
pie
title 用户邮箱状态
"已验证": 70
"未验证": 30
结尾
到这里,我们已经完成了使用 MySQL 的基础操作,包括创建数据库、表、插入、查询、更新和删除数据。对于初学者来说,掌握这些基本操作是开启数据库开发的重要一步。
在实际的开发过程中,你可能还需要进一步学习 SQL 语言的复杂查询、索引和事务处理等内容。建议你尝试进行更复杂的数据场景,并逐步深入理解数据库的设计和优化。
如果在实践中遇到问题,不妨参考官方文档或社区的讨论。相信通过不断的实践和学习,你会成为一名出色的开发者!